Mikel Arguinarena Lara (born 27 June 1991) is a Chilean footballer who plays for San Marcos de Arica as a midfielder.[1] [2]
As a youth player, Arguinarena was with both Universidad Católica and Universidad de Chile in his homeland. Abroad, he was with Reggina in Italy and Real Sociedad in Spain.[3]
